Male BP wrapping water bowl?
Just checked on my snakes, and I noticed my male was all balled up but upon closer inspection I realized he was coiled in/around his water bowl. His cool side is at 78 and his hot is at 86. A little low I know but it's cold and raining here today. His humidity is at 70%, a little higher than usual but probably because of the rain. Anybody think it's odd that he was trying to ball up in his bowl? He's never done it before. He also hissed when I tried to move him so I could check if he had water. He sometimes hisses when I go to pick him up but is then fine, but he kept hissing every time I tried so after a few attempts I just left him alone.

You suuuuuuuure it's a male? I've never heard of males bowl wrapping and don't see why one would unless he were overheated, and your temps don't sound hot enough for that to happen easily.
Females will often cool seek and bowl wrap during follicular growth, just prior to ovulation.
